Ticket: PRNT-spooler sign-off required before release. The Inkwright spooler microservice now accepts jobs over mutual TLS and stores queued documents encrypted at rest. Changes in this release: new admin endpoint for purging stuck queues, rate limiting on job submission, and removal of the legacy plaintext listener. Security review should focus on the purge endpoint's authorization checks and key rotation for the at-rest encryption. Release is blocked pending sign-off from the responsible engineer, named below.

named custodian: Ulaix Wenwyn

// MAX_PARALLEL_SEGMENTS caps how many video segments a single Brindlewood
// transcode worker will process concurrently. Raising it improves throughput
// on short clips but starves memory on 4K sources, which is why it was
// lowered after the autumn capacity incident. Do not change this without
// running the full soak suite on the staging farm and getting sign-off
// from the pipeline team. The value was last validated against the build
// identified by the token below.

pipeline stamp: htk3_a71

**Q: Why does the waveform preview render blank on encrypted uploads?**

Because Soundrift's preview worker can't decrypt assets without the preview keystore mounted — check that first before blaming the renderer. If you're reviewing the `wavepeek` branch, note the worker now lazy-loads the keystore on first request, so the initial preview may 404 once. That's expected. To run the decryption path locally you'll need to unlock the dev keystore yourself; it prompts on startup. When it asks, enter the recovery phrase shown below.

unlock words, hahip-baduf: holwyn-istath-julvan